when I added the detection I could delete it in Safe Mode. Do you have administrative rights? Let Spybot scan on startup in Safe Mode and try to fix the command service.
Also have a look in the windows\system32 directory. There has to be a randomized directory where the command.exe is located in. Please also delete it in safe mode.

If this doesn´t solve the problem please send us your *complete* Spybot bug report: Therefore enter Spybot-S&D, let it scan, try to fix the problems (!) and then go to "Tools/View Report". Tick on all the 10 checkboxes (leave "Do not report disabled or known legitimate items" unchecked) you can find there and click on "View Report". Now choose "Export" and save the file to your desktop. Then attach it to your email and send it again to detections(at) spybot.info.
